HMRC's Code of Practice Eight (COP8)
HMRC's Code of Practice 8 (COP8) sets out the expectations for how HMRC conducts its investigations into potential non-compliance. It provides a clear framework for both HMRC and taxpayers, ensuring fairness in the process.
